Predictive Attention

Date:

18 March 2024 - 19 March 2024

Location:

Center for Advanced Studies Seestr. 13 80802 Munich

Workshop led by Dr. Siyi Chen (CAS Researcher in Residence/LMU)

Active and predictive perception is considered essential for adaptive behavior in complex and dynamic environments and is thus at the forefront of current scientific theorizing in Cognitive Neuroscience. The speakers represent different theoretical stances and methodological approaches (from behavioral through neuroscientific to computational-modeling approaches). The overarching goal is to clarify where and why divergences arise and identify the most promising directions for resolving them.

Participants include: Dr. Tom Beesley (Lancaster University, UK), Dr. Sage Boettcher (University of Oxford, UK), Prof. Floris de Lange (Radboud University Nijmegen, Netherlands), Prof. Fang Fang (Peking University, China), Prof. Nikolaus Kriegeskorte (Columbia University, USA), Dr. Marius Peelen (Radboud University Nijmegen, Netherlands), and Prof. Heleen Slagter (Vrije Universiteit Amsterdam, Netherlands)
